rep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
use and recommend sleepy_penguin 3.0.0
2011-05-21
Eric Wong
use a
n
d rec
o
m
m
e
nd
sl
e
epy_penguin 3
.
0
.
0
commit
|
commitdiff
|
tree
2011-05-21
Eric Wong
t0044: inc
r
eas
e
test
r
eliability
commit
|
commitdiff
|
tree
2011-05-21
Eric
Won
g
try
_
defe
r
: enable
d
o
cum
e
ntati
o
n
commit
|
commitdiff
|
tree
2011-05-21
Eric Wong
xepoll_threa
d
_pool
/
cli
e
nt: improve aut
o
push suppor
t
commit
|
commitdiff
|
tree
2011-05-20
Eri
c
Wong
.
gitignore: ad
d
tag
s
/TAGS
f
i
l
es
commit
|
commitdiff
|
tree
2011-05-20
Eric Wong
add
te
s
ts for Kgi
o
autopush on Linux
commit
|
commitdiff
|
tree
2011-05-20
E
r
ic Wong
add tes
t
fo
r
SIGQUIT
d
isconnect
commit
|
commitdiff
|
tree
2011-05-20
Eric
W
ong
eve
n
t
_mach
i
ne: di
s
co
n
n
e
ct idl
e
clients at on
S
IGQ
U
IT
commit
|
commitdiff
|
tree
2011-05-20
Er
i
c Wo
n
g
c
li
e
nt: use kgio_write
a
cross the bo
a
r
d
commit
|
commitdiff
|
tree
2011-05-20
E
ric Wong
cool
i
o
*
+ *epol
l
*: drop keepalive
c
lie
n
ts on SIGQUIT
commit
|
commitdiff
|
tree
2011-05-20
Er
i
c Won
g
e
poll/xepoll: more consistent clie
n
t implementations
commit
|
commitdiff
|
tree
2011-05-18
Eric Wong
doc: recommend io_splice 4
.
1
.
1 o
r
later
commit
|
commitdiff
|
tree
2011-05-16
E
ric W
o
ng
R
a
inbo
w
s! 3
.
3
.
0 - do
c
improvem
e
nts
a
nd more
commit
|
commitdiff
|
tree
2011-05-16
Eric
W
o
n
g
wr
i
ter_
t
hread_*:
fix
s
endfile
d
etection under Ruby 1
.
8
commit
|
commitdiff
|
tree
2011-05-16
Er
i
c Wo
n
g
docum
e
nt RubyGe
m
requir
e
ments
commit
|
commitdiff
|
tree
2011-05-16
E
r
ic
Wong
doc: cl
e
an
u
p rdoc for Rainbows mod
u
le
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
u
se :pool_size for RLIMIT_NPROC with thread pool models
commit
|
commitdiff
|
tree
2011-05-16
Eric Wo
n
g
more reliable shu
t
down
f
or
e
po
l
l concurren
c
y models
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
test
s
: unify checks for copy_stream
and threaded app
.
.
.
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
a
d
d "copy_stream" co
n
fig direc
t
ive
commit
|
commitdiff
|
tree
2011-05-10
Er
i
c Wong
c
onfigurator: update user-facin
g
documenta
t
ion
commit
|
commitdiff
|
tree
2011-05-10
Eric Wong
max_body: documenta
t
ion u
p
d
ates
commit
|
commitdiff
|
tree
2011-05-10
Eric Wong
LIC
E
N
S
E: a
d
d
G
PLv3 to license terms
commit
|
commitdiff
|
tree
2011-05-10
E
r
ic Wong
configurator: mov
e
validation logic over
commit
|
commitdiff
|
tree
2011-05-09
E
r
i
c
Wong
doc
:
better d
o
cum
e
nt
:
po
o
l
_
size
options
commit
|
commitdiff
|
tree
2011-05-09
E
ric Wo
n
g
TODO: mis
c
updates
commit
|
commitdiff
|
tree
2011-05-09
Eric
W
o
ng
doc:
u
p
d
ate comparis
o
n an
d
README
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
xepoll_
t
hr
e
ad
_
*:
add rdoc for users
commit
|
commitdiff
|
tree
2011-05-09
Eric Won
g
x
epo
l
l_thr
e
ad_s
p
awn/client: r
e
m
o
ve
r
doc
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
max_
b
ody: rd
o
c update
s
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
x
e
p
o
ll_t
h
read_pool: add optional
:
pool_s
i
ze argumen
t
commit
|
commitdiff
|
tree
2011-05-09
Eric Wong
s
pli
t
o
u
t
poo
l
_siz
e
modul
e
commit
|
commitdiff
|
tree
2011-05-09
Er
i
c
Wong
t0041: les
s
co
n
fu
s
i
n
g sk
i
p message
commit
|
commitdiff
|
tree
2011-05-09
E
r
ic Wong
add X
E
pollThrea
d
Poo
l
con
c
ur
r
ency option
commit
|
commitdiff
|
tree
2011-05-08
Eric W
o
n
g
Revert "
e
poll: fixe
s
fo
r
R
uby 1
.
9
.
3dev"
commit
|
commitdiff
|
tree
2011-05-08
Eric Won
g
join_thread
s
: simplify
th
r
ead
s
toppag
e
check
commit
|
commitdiff
|
tree
2011-05-08
Eric W
o
n
g
require
k
gio
2
.
4
.
0
commit
|
commitdiff
|
tree
2011-05-08
Eric
W
ong
epo
l
l_wai
t
:
flags argument is unu
s
ed
commit
|
commitdiff
|
tree
2011-05-08
Eric Wong
xepoll:
c
lean
u
p acceptor logic
commit
|
commitdiff
|
tree
2011-05-08
E
ric Wong
xepoll_thread_spaw
n
:
rework
a
cceptor l
o
gi
c
commit
|
commitdiff
|
tree
2011-05-08
Eric Wo
n
g
xepo
l
l_thre
a
d
_spawn/client: c
l
ose returns nil
commit
|
commitdiff
|
tree
2011-05-08
E
ric W
o
ng
xe
p
o
ll_
t
hr
e
a
d
_spawn: inline needles
s
meth
o
d
commit
|
commitdiff
|
tree
2011-05-08
Eric Wong
process_client: fix p
i
p
e
line_ready arity
commit
|
commitdiff
|
tree
2011-05-06
Eric Wong
re
m
ov
e
unnecess
a
ry variabl
e
assignments
commit
|
commitdiff
|
tree
2011-05-06
E
ric
W
ong
tes
t
_
i
s
o
late: u
p
da
t
e to
l
a
t
es
t
rai
n
drops a
n
d unicorn
commit
|
commitdiff
|
tree
2011-05-06
Eric Wong
ens
u
re s
o
me r
e
quir
e
s get
l
oa
d
e
d
in master
commit
|
commitdiff
|
tree
2011-05-05
Eric Wong
h
ttp_serv
e
r: XEpollThreadSpa
w
n sets RLIMIT_NPROC
commit
|
commitdiff
|
tree
2011-05-03
Eric W
o
ng
Rainbows! defaults more
D
RY
commit
|
commitdiff
|
tree
2011-05-03
E
r
i
c Wong
s/m
a
x_bytes
/
clie
n
t_max_body
_
size/
for consistenc
y
commit
|
commitdiff
|
tree
2011-05-03
Eric Wong
add client_header_buffer_size
tuning parameter
commit
|
commitdiff
|
tree
2011-05-02
Eric W
o
ng
rainbows:
get rid of MODEL_W
O
RK
E
R
_CONNECTIONS co
n
stant
commit
|
commitdiff
|
tree
2011-05-02
Eric
W
ong
h
ttp_ser
v
er
:
default
all optio
n
s to
5
0
connect
i
ons
commit
|
commitdiff
|
tree
2011-05-01
E
r
ic
W
ong
d
oc: add Sandbox documen
t
commit
|
commitdiff
|
tree
2011-04-30
Eric Wong
lower header buffer
s
izes for sync
h
ronou
s
m
o
dels
commit
|
commitdiff
|
tree
2011-04-30
Eric W
o
ng
x
e
poll_thread_spawn: lower memory us
a
ge
commit
|
commitdiff
|
tree
2011-04-29
E
r
ic Wong
e
poll:
f
ix timeout
commit
|
commitdiff
|
tree
2011-04-29
Eric Wong
xepoll_thread_spawn: fix race condition with acceptors
commit
|
commitdiff
|
tree
2011-04-29
E
r
ic Wong
xepoll_thread_spawn
:
i
niti
a
l
impl
e
mentat
i
on
commit
|
commitdiff
|
tree
2011-04-28
Eric Wong
d
oc
u
ment epoll and
x
e
poll
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
doc: st
o
p
r
e
comm
e
nding Fibe
r
* stuff
commit
|
commitdiff
|
tree
2011-04-26
E
r
i
c Wong
revactor: re
m
ove documentation
for internal methods
commit
|
commitdiff
|
tree
2011-04-26
Eri
c
Wong
revactor: do not recommend
,
upstream is dorma
n
t
commit
|
commitdiff
|
tree
2011-04-26
Eric Wong
stream_file:
h
i
d
e internals
commit
|
commitdiff
|
tree
2011-04-26
Eric Wo
n
g
make all concurre
n
cy options use
50 by
d
efaul
t
commit
|
commitdiff
|
tree
2011-04-21
Er
i
c W
o
ng
thread_tim
e
out: annota
t
e as much as possible
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
increase RLIMIT_NP
R
OC for thread-crazy folks
commit
|
commitdiff
|
tree
2011-04-21
Er
i
c Wong
http_
s
erv
e
r:
attempt t
o
inc
r
ea
s
e RLIMI
T
_NOFILE
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
th
r
ead_timeout: d
o
cum
e
n
t Thread
.
pass usage
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
j
oin_thre
a
ds: workaround b
l
ocking acc
e
p
t() is
s
ues
commit
|
commitdiff
|
tree
2011-04-21
Eric Wong
bump d
e
pendenc
y
t
o
Uni
c
orn 3
.
6
.
0
commit
|
commitdiff
|
tree
2011-04-19
E
r
i
c Wong
htt
p
_ser
v
er: le
s
s hacky loadin
g
of conc
u
rrency model
commit
|
commitdiff
|
tree
2011-04-11
Er
i
c Wong
t
:
only enable Revactor tests under 1
.
9
.
2
for now
commit
|
commitdiff
|
tree
2011-04-11
Er
i
c Wong
epo
l
l:
fixes for Ruby 1
.
9
.
3dev
commit
|
commitdiff
|
tree
2011-04-11
Eric
Wong
t
h
read_tim
e
out:
r
ewri
t
e for safe
t
y
commit
|
commitdiff
|
tree
2011-04-10
Eric Wong
thr
e
ad
_
po
o
l
:
g
et used of
dead
t
h
r
e
ad_joi
n
method
commit
|
commitdiff
|
tree
2011-03-22
Eric W
o
ng
queue_pool: swi
t
ch t
o
ivar
s
to
pro
t
ect i
n
ternals
commit
|
commitdiff
|
tree
2011-03-22
Eric Wong
thr
e
ad_pool+thread_spawn
:
update documentation
commit
|
commitdiff
|
tree
2011-03-21
Eric Wong
sim
p
lify LISTENERS
cl
o
sing
commit
|
commitdiff
|
tree
2011-03-20
Eric
Wong
f
ix various
w
arnin
g
s with "check-warning
s
" targ
e
t
commit
|
commitdiff
|
tree
2011-03-20
E
ric Wong
pkg
.
mk: new task for check
i
n
g
Ruby warnings
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
f
ibe
r
/io: fix b
r
oken
call to Kgio
.
t
r
ywrite
commit
|
commitdiff
|
tree
2011-03-15
Eric Wong
R
ainbows! 3
.
2
.
0 - t
r
y
i
ng t
o
s
e
nd files to slow
clients
commit
|
commitdiff
|
tree
2011-03-15
E
r
ic Wong
bu
m
p U
n
icorn dependency to 3
.
5
.
0
commit
|
commitdiff
|
tree
2011-03-10
Eri
c
Wong
doc: update Static_Fil
e
s for n
e
w se
n
d
f
ile
g
em
commit
|
commitdiff
|
tree
2011-03-10
Eric Wong
s
w
it
c
h from IO
#
sendfil
e
_non
b
lock
to IO#trys
e
ndfil
e
commit
|
commitdiff
|
tree
2011-03-10
Er
i
c Wo
n
g
test_
i
s
olate: bump dependencies
commit
|
commitdiff
|
tree
2011-02-28
Eric Wong
use IO#wait
instead of
IO
.
select
f
or single readers
commit
|
commitdiff
|
tree
2011-02-16
E
ric Wo
n
g
RE
A
DME:
c
larify license t
e
r
m
s and v
e
rsio
n
s
commit
|
commitdiff
|
tree
2011-02-15
Eric
W
o
ng
tests: u
p
dates
f
or cramp 0
.
12
commit
|
commitdiff
|
tree
2011-02-11
E
r
ic Wong
Rainbows
!
3
.
1
.
0 - mino
r
updates
commit
|
commitdiff
|
tree
2011-02-11
Er
i
c Wong
pkg
.
mk: upd
a
te to the latest
commit
|
commitdiff
|
tree
2011-02-11
E
ric Wong
r
evers
e
_
p
r
oxy: do
c
ume
n
t as "n
o
t r
e
ady fo
r
p
roduction"
commit
|
commitdiff
|
tree
2011-02-08
Eric Wong
Revert
t/bin/un
u
sed_l
i
sten
simpli
f
ication
commit
|
commitdiff
|
tree
2011-02-08
Eric Won
g
new tes
t
for opt
i
onal :pool_size handli
n
g
commit
|
commitdiff
|
tree
2011-02-08
E
r
ic Wong
gemspec
:
remove unnecessary st
a
tements
commit
|
commitdiff
|
tree
2011-02-08
Eri
c
Wong
doc: rdoc c
l
e
a
n
u
ps a
n
d
f
i
x
es
commit
|
commitdiff
|
tree
2011-02-06
Eric W
o
ng
min
i
mize &block usag
e
f
o
r yield
commit
|
commitdiff
|
tree
2011-02-06
Eric W
o
ng
kill some unnec
e
ssary &block usage
commit
|
commitdiff
|
tree
2011-02-05
Er
i
c
Wong
*
epoll
:
refa
c
t
o
r c
o
m
m
on loop code
commit
|
commitdiff
|
tree
2011-02-05
Eric Wong
*epoll:
c
o
nsolidate re-
r
un logic
commit
|
commitdiff
|
tree
next